A reflected ceiling plan rcp is a drawing that shows which shows the items are located on the ceiling of a room or space. Determine the ceilings perimeter.

It is referred to as a reflected ceiling plan since it is drawn to display a view of the ceiling as if it was reflected onto a mirror on the floor.
